MPC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2019 in Review

1,189 of the 5,075 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Marathon Petroleum (MPC) for Q4 2019, worth a combined $30.4B — down 0.14% from $30.4B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 195 funds opened new MPC positions and 89 closed out — a net gain of 106 holders — while 378 added to existing stakes and 454 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Boston Partners, adding an estimated $262M. The largest seller was Morgan Stanley, cutting an estimated $229M.
